Javascript-форум (https://javascript.ru/forum/)
-   Ваши сайты и скрипты (https://javascript.ru/forum/project/)
-   -   Snakeskin (https://javascript.ru/forum/project/35057-snakeskin.html)

kobezzza 06.10.2014 17:31

Выпустил патч 5.1.10.
Обновил доку.

kobezzza 09.10.2014 14:27

Готовится к релизу SS 6.0:

1) Параметр .xml заменён на .doctype, для которого можно задать 'html' или 'xhtml';
2) Параметр .commonJS заменён на .exports = 'commonJS', т.к. помимо commonJS будет global и requirejs;
3) Добавлен параметр .replaceUndef;
4) Добавлен параметр .lineSeparator.

В остальном исправления ошибок и небольшие доработки.

Safort 09.10.2014 19:15

kobezzza,
Цитата:

Готовится к релизу SS 6.0
Воу-воу, тебя разрабы Хома не покусали часом?)
//как я понимаю, это всё из-за semver'а?

kobezzza 09.10.2014 19:25

Цитата:

Сообщение от Safort (Сообщение 334471)
kobezzza,

Воу-воу, тебя разрабы Хома не покусали часом?)

:D

Цитата:

Сообщение от Safort (Сообщение 334471)
//как я понимаю, это всё из-за semver'а?

Угу, просто вносятся несовместимости с прошлой версией, поэтому нужно обновить мажорную цифру, а вообще это будет просто большой патч с исправлениями багов.

kobezzza 10.10.2014 16:36

Закончил работу над 6-й версией SS, завтра обновлю доку.

ЗЫ: тока ща обратил внимание, что исходный код уже 17k, жесть :)

kobezzza 11.10.2014 11:43

Выпустил патч 6.0.3.
Обновил доку.

nerv_ 11.10.2014 12:13

Цитата:

Сообщение от kobezzza
Выпустил патч 6.0.3.
Обновил доку.

Знаю, что надоел это ссылкой, но, есть у меня самоиграйка. Так вот, проблема мажорной версии для меня в том, что надо писать migrate и быть готовым к куче вопросов на этот счет.

Ты хоть ссылки кидай на релизы, а то ходить далеко =)

kobezzza 11.10.2014 12:20

Ну с недавнего времени для всех своих проектов я веду лог изменений, например,
https://github.com/kobezzza/Snakeski...ter/HISTORY.md

Цитата:

Ты хоть ссылки кидай на релизы, а то ходить далеко =)
Оки

ЗЫ: думаю, что 6-я версия будет последней мажорной, т.к. вроде шаблонка за 2 года разработки полностью состоялась (для меня это был колоссальный опыт) и теперь разве что будут делать патчи и добавлять фичи по мере надобности.

Safort 11.10.2014 12:32

kobezzza,
Цитата:

ЗЫ: тока ща обратил внимание, что исходный код уже 17k, жесть
Как ты управляешься с таким объёмом кода в одиночку?

kobezzza 11.10.2014 12:36

Цитата:

Сообщение от Safort (Сообщение 334829)
kobezzza,

Как ты управляешься с таким объёмом кода в одиночку?

Разбиение на файлы, постоянный рефакторинг, тщательное документирование, куча тулз для статического анализа кода, тесты, тесты, тесты.


Часовой пояс GMT +3, время: 19:04.